Let's dive into a comprehensive comparison of the Oppo A77 and the OnePlus 11, dissecting their specifications and uncovering what they truly offer the everyday user.
1. Specifications Breakdown
Feature | Oppo A77 | OnePlus 11 | Real-World Implications |
---|---|---|---|
Design | |||
Dimensions | 163.8 x 75.1 x 8 mm, 190g | 163.1 x 74.1 x 8.5 mm, 205g | OnePlus 11 is slightly more compact and heavier; both feel substantial in hand. |
Build Materials | Plastic | Glass front (Gorilla Glass Victus), glass back | OnePlus 11 offers a more premium feel and potentially better durability. |
Display | |||
Type | IPS LCD, 90Hz | LTPO3 Fluid AMOLED, 120Hz | OnePlus 11 boasts superior contrast, vibrant colors, smoother scrolling, and power-efficient variable refresh rate. |
Size | 6.56 inches | 6.7 inches | OnePlus 11 offers a slightly larger viewing area. |
Resolution | 720 x 1612 pixels (269 ppi) | 1440 x 3216 pixels (525 ppi) | OnePlus 11 delivers significantly sharper visuals. |
Performance | |||
Chipset | Mediatek Dimensity 810 (6 nm) |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 (4 nm) | OnePlus 11 provides dramatically faster processing speeds, smoother multitasking, and superior gaming performance. |
CPU | Octa-core (2x2.4 GHz A76 & 6x2.0 GHz A55) | Octa-core (1x3.2 GHz X3 &...) | OnePlus 11's more advanced CPU architecture ensures significantly better performance. |
RAM | 6GB | 12GB/16GB | OnePlus 11 offers much more RAM for seamless multitasking and demanding applications. |
Camera | |||
Rear Camera | 13MP main | 50MP main, 48MP ultrawide, 32MP telephoto | OnePlus 11 provides significantly better image quality, versatility with multiple lenses, and advanced features. |
Video Recording | 1080p@30fps | 8K@24fps, 4K@60fps | OnePlus 11 offers superior video resolution and frame rates. |
Battery Life | |||
Capacity | 5000 mAh | 5000 mAh | Similar battery capacities suggest comparable longevity, though real-world usage will vary. |
Charging | Fast charging (details not provided) | 100W fast charging | OnePlus 11 offers drastically faster charging speeds. |
2. Key Insights
- Performance: The OnePlus 11 is a clear winner in performance, thanks to its cutting-edge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 processor and ample RAM. This translates to blazing-fast speeds, effortless multitasking, and smooth gaming. The Oppo A77, while sufficient for basic tasks, will likely struggle with demanding applications.
- Display: The OnePlus 11's LTPO3 AMOLED display is a visual treat, offering vibrant colors, deep blacks, and a buttery-smooth 120Hz refresh rate. The Oppo A77's IPS LCD is functional but pales in comparison.
- Camera: The OnePlus 11's triple-camera system offers versatility and significantly better image quality. The inclusion of an ultrawide and telephoto lens expands creative possibilities. The Oppo A77's single rear camera is basic and lacks advanced features.
- Value: The Oppo A77 targets budget-conscious users, while the OnePlus 11 sits in the premium mid-range.
